Problem

Current wireless communication systems face challenges in effectively reporting small data transmission failures in 3GPP networks, which hinders network optimization and quality-of-service verification, as existing methods often require manual testing and lack efficient failure detection mechanisms.

Innovation Solution

An apparatus and method for detecting and reporting small data transmission failures in 3GPP networks, which includes receiving a configuration for a small data transmission procedure, detecting failures based on specific criteria such as cell re-selection, timer expiration, or maximum transmission attempts, and transmitting a failure report to the access node, including reasons and configuration details.

PatentEP4418720A1Failure reporting in small data transmission
Publication Date: 2024.08.21 NOKIA TECHNOLOGIES OY

AI summary

Various example embodiments relate to transmission failure reporting in a communication network An apparatus may comprise: means for receiving, from an access node of a communication network, a configuration for a small data transmission procedure; means for detecting an occurrence of a failure associated with the small data transmission procedure; and means for transmitting, to the access node, a failure report comprising information including at least one of the following: a reason for the failure, information relating to the configuration for the small data transmission procedure used during the occurrence of the failure, or information relating to a random access procedure used during the occurrence of the failure.
